Cape Grace Hotel Completes Bar Renovation, Announces Perks

In Cape Town, the Cape Grace Hotel's Bascule bar is emerging from a five-week renovation. 

What makes it special? We hear the bar stocks a global collection of more than 500 whiskies from nearly every producing region, including Scotland, Ireland, USA and Canada. There is also a selection of the Cape's finest wines courtesy of Bascule Vinothèque.

And to accompany the drinks, a tapas menu has been created by Executive Chef Malika van Reenen. The snacks are available for lunch and dinner, either on the deck outside or inside in the more intimate bar area.

Bascule's setting offers great access to the Victoria & Alfred yacht basin and one of the most popular shopping districts in Cape Town. Cool touch: The bar's elite whisky club offers members the opportunity to own private whisky bins for personalized consumption. Members' privileges include exclusive guided tasting evenings and expert whisky purchasing advice under the leadership of Bascule Manager George Novitskas. Members also receive their own personalized cut crystal whisky tumbler and engraved plaques for their whisky lockers. Bascule Vinothèque invites wine connoisseurs, private collectors and companies to store their wines in private bins of the Vinothèque's temperature- and humidity-controlled cellar, for ideal maturation.
